55 days. Adorable and prolific, Dora will win you over with sturdy, upright, very compact plants that are draped with heavy trusses of tasty tomatoes. The heart-shaped fruit line up on long bunches and turn from light green to bright red. R...

Small garden tomatoes
Heartbreaker’s Dora Red is great small tomato that can be grown indoors or outside. We grew it out in an open porch that kept it from getting too much sun. We kept it on the top shelf of a four shelf steel rack. This is a plant that is easy to grow and produces good tasting tomatoes. As a retired high school teacher, I see this plant can be used by students to learn about growing tomatoes.

Cute and prolific little plant
I started these from seed and had good germination. They grew happily in 8" pots in zone 9b (California zone 14). The plants are covered with fruit and I started harvesting beginning in July. They appear to be quite determinate and stopped growing and setting fruit after reaching about 14-18" in height.

Great Compact Tomato Plant
I have had great luck with the Heartbreakers Dora Red tomato. I live in North Central Washington, where it gets very hot in the summer. Tomatoes love it here. When the seedling arrived it was in very good shape with plenty of buds. I have harvested 10 tomatoes so far and it is July 7th. There are plenty more tomatoes to ripen on the plant. The fruit is sweet with a good bite to it. Great on their own or in a pasta salad.
